Purposeful Growth
The University of West Florida will target increases in enrollment to provide for a more vibrant campus experience and improve our resources base without eroding our commitment to an enriched personal experience for every student.
Growth
- 12,126 students at end of add/drop period, Fall 2011 - Reached goal of 12,000 one year early
- New Freshman
- Applications: 5,629, an increase of 20%
- Enrolled: 1,463, an increase of 17%
- In state: 1,343
- Out of state: 120, 36% increase
- 34% of class ethnically diverse, a 9 percent increase
- Average high school grade point average: 3.48
- Average SAT: 1,007
- Average ACT: 22.75, higher than state of Florida average of 19
